IBR is an earnings -based scholar mortgage fee plan that adjusts month-to-month funds primarily based on debtors ’earnings. Qualifying debtors for scholar loans can get hold of forgiveness after 20 or 25 years of funds, relying on the time of acquiring their mortgage. that it Currently the only payment plan Accessible that gives a option to tolerance for present debtors.

Are there different choices for tolerance alongside IBR?

In addition to IBR, the present debtors may have the choice of subsequent 12 months underneath the brand new legislation supported by Republicans that had been accredited earlier this month: Payment assistance plan.

The brand new fee help plan can present barely decrease month-to-month funds for some debtors, however the plan requires 30 years of certified funds earlier than loans are tolerated, in comparison with 20 to 25 years underneath the present IBR. So you’ll find yourself paying extra profit over time.

Anybody who will get scholar loans after July 2026 may have two fee choices solely: RAP and commonplace fee plan.
